The University of Minnesota Internal Medicine Residency Program is an ACGME accredited program located in the diverse Metropolitan Area of Minnesota. The program itself boast three different hospital systems which include the University of Minnesota Medical Center (Public, Tertiary/Quaternary referral center, Transplant Center, Advanced-Heart Failure and ECMO center), Regions Hospital (Private, Non-for-profit, ACS Verified Level 1 Trauma Center, Burn Center), and Minneapolis Veterans Affairs Medical Center (Hosts Largest Research Program in the United States, one of four VAMC’s to serve polytrauma/traumatic brain injuries).
